Understanding Hardwood Flooring
What is Hardwood Flooring?
Hardwood floor covering is made from solid wood and can be classified into 2 primary categories: solid wood and crafted wood. Solid wood is milled from a solitary item of wood, while crafted hardwood consists of several layers that provide added stability.

Types of Wood Flooring
Solid Wood vs. Engineered Hardwood
Solid hardwood is often favored for its authenticity however can be prone to wetness. Engineered hardwood, on the other hand, supplies moisture resistance because of its split building, making it an excellent option for cellars or locations prone to humidity.
Popular Timber Species
Different timber types use distinct looks and qualities:
- Oak: Recognized for its resilience and popular grain patterns. Maple: Uses a lighter tone with refined grain variations. Cherry: Rich in shade and creates an aging over time.

The Installment Process Begins
Pre-Installation Preparations
Before installation begins, ensure your subfloor is clean, dry, and level. It's also essential to acclimate your hardwood planks in your home setting for at the very least 72 hours before installation.
